Jammu: Scores of members of Sikh community today staged demonstrations in this winter capital against the alleged desecration of a religious book in the neighbouring state of Punjab.
The members of various Sikh organisations today converged at Digiana Ashram and staged strong protests over the desecration of a religious book by unknown persons in Faridabad district of the neighbouring state, witnesses told Kashmir Reader.
Chanting slogans against the Punjab government, the protesters blocked the Jammu-Pathankot highway with burnt tyres and rocks seeking identification and punishment for the guilty.
“The protesters also torched effigy of Punjab Chief Minister Prakash Singh Badal,” witnesses said.
